Application: | Cytidine 5′-diphosphocholine (CDP-choline) is generated by choline-phosphate cytidylyltransferase EC 2.7.7.15 in support of the synthesis of phosphatidylcholine. CDP-choline is being used in studies of its affects on neurorecovery. |
Application: | Cytidine 5′-diphosphocholine sodium salt hydrate has been used as a component of the mixture during the ribonucleotide reductase (RNR) assay in mouse primary pancreatic acinar cells. |
Biochem/physiol Actions: | Cytidine 5′-diphosphocholine (CDP-choline) is an endogenous compound that plays an important role in the synthesis of phospholipids in the cell membrane. It acts as a choline donor for the biosynthesis of acetylcholine and phosphatidylcholine, a neuronal membrane phospholipid. CDP-choline enhances brain metabolism and influences the levels of various neurotransmitters including dopamine, epinephrine, and acetylcholine. It has been studied as a neuroprotectant after cerebral ischemia. CDP-choline is observed to exhibit therapeutic effects against cognitive impairment arising from multiple causes, cerebral vascular diseases, after-head trauma, and Alzheimer′s disease. |
